The Fifth Toy Story Film Trailer Pits The Beloved Duo Versus a Tablet Computer
Exactly 30 years after the original Toy Story film was released, launching the animation giant as a major film company and bringing viewers to iconic figures like Woody (the actor) and the space ranger (the voice talent), who are now household names.
Coming in 2026, the fifth installment is set to arrive. The initial preview for Toy Story 5 appeared recently, providing a glimpse into the storyline but keeping fans wondering how it will resolve the conclusion of Toy Story 4.
Bonnie's New Toy: A Digital Device Frightens the Toys
The preview reveals the young girl — who inherited Andy's toys when he left for college — getting a brand new plaything, one that alarms Woody, Buzz, and the crew. Bonnie gets her first tablet computer, and she is excited about it.
Theoretically, the frog-shaped tablet will come to life just like the rest of her playthings. However, the toys seem to view it as a threat intending to supplant them, which it probably is.
Woody's Return: Unanswered Questions from Toy Story 4
An element the trailer avoids is why the sheriff is returned with his friends in Bonnie's room. The end of Toy Story 4 saw him embark on a fresh journey with the shepherdess (Annie Potts), traveling with a carnival and assisting giveaway items find good homes.
Certainly, the filmmakers will address the consequences of Toy Story 4 in the movie. Seeing him appear in Bonnie's room without warning is a little strange, however. It also makes us wonder whether Bo Peep will have come back with Woody. And what about the stuntman toy (Keanu Reeves)?
Continuity from the Last Installment
Fortunately, some aspects are carrying over from the prior film. The last thing the cowboy did before departing for his fresh path was pass his sheriff badge to Jessie (the voice actor), leaving her in charge of the toy domain. The clip shows the insignia pinned to her shirt.
Hopefully she is still the key figure among the group.
Toy Story 5 arrives in theaters on June 19, 2026.
